THE STATE vs CAPTAIN JAGJIT SINGH

The Supreme Court held that in cases involving the Indian Official Secrets Act, 1923, particularly under Sections 3 and 5, the High Court erred in granting bail without adequately considering the nature of the charges. The Court emphasized that the application for bail should be assessed under the assumption that the offence was non-bailable under Section 3, necessitating a thorough evaluation of factors such as the seriousness of the offence and the possibility of absconding. The Court ultimately overturned the High Court's decision, reinforcing the need for careful judicial scrutiny in non-bailable cases.
